El Chupacabra sighting in Texas, check this video from channel4 news:
to my surprise the DNA tests showed that the creature was only a dog. However i think maybe they cover it up to prevent public histeria. anyway where it is the el chupacabra or not, this creature is still live somewhere in texas and in latin america and i`m sure we will hear more stories like this. more information: El Chupacabra El Chupacabra pictures El Chupacabra video